Motor Vehicle Attorneys

Motor vehicle lawyers can to help you get a fair settlement. They collaborate with accident reconstruction specialists to gather evidence and show the cause of the accident. They will also negotiate on your behalf with the at-fault driver's insurance company.

Auto accident cases often include a specific type of litigation referred to as product liability. These cases assert that a manufacturer's defective automobile or its components resulted in the accident and injuries.

A motor vehicle attorney is a lawyer who specialises in cases involving car accidents. They can help you file an action against the other driver for an accident you caused, or they can defend you against a lawsuit brought against you. They can also help you in fighting traffic violations that could affect your driving record.

Automobile accidents are a tort case and they usually derive from the tort principle of negligence. Negligence is the failure to exercise the same amount of care as reasonable people in similar circumstances. Road rage, drunk driving, and distracted drivers are the leading causes of accidents in the automobile.

They are well-versed in accident reports, investigating witness statements and analyzing police evidence. They know which documents are necessary to support your claim and will work hard to obtain them. They will also reach out to insurance companies and other parties involved in the incident to obtain the insurance coverage and payments to which you are entitled. An experienced attorney will not accept a low offer from the insurance company and will be ready to go to trial if needed.

DMV hearings

You may be asked by the DMV to appear at a hearing in case your driving privileges have been suspended or removed. These hearings aren't related to courts and do not involve judges, but they have a significant impact. An experienced attorney can help you through the process and protect your rights under the law.

DMV hearings can be extremely complex and lengthy. The lawyer will explain the rules of road, review evidence and question witnesses. The lawyer will also advocate to get the best possible outcome for the case. If the case is decided, based on the hearing, you may keep your license or have it reinstated.

A DUI lawyer can assist you defend yourself in the DMV hearing. The hearing will take place before a hearing officer and will be focused on whether the driver was under the influence at the moment of the incident. Since the hearing is a civil action and not a criminal matter, the burden of proof is less than in a criminal trial. This makes it easier for law enforcement personnel to prevail at the hearing.

A hearing is an official procedure that must be requested in writing and delivered to the DMV office. You can request a hearing within 30 days after your arrest. If you don't request a hearing in the time frame allowed your license will be suspended.
